With all the crazy announcements that we heard today. Threads-Switch between text, Facebook chat, and Windows Live Messenger, within the same conversation. Groups-Group contacts into personalized Live Tiles to see the latest status updates and quickly send a text, email, or IM to the whole group, right from the Start Screen.
